" 71 AGENDA YAKIMA CITY COUNCIL June 1, 2021 City Hall -- Council Chambers 5:30 p.. Regular Meeting 1. Roll Call 2- Open Discussion for the Good of the Order A. Coronavirus (COVID-19) update B. Presentations / Recognitions / Introductions i. Presentation on LEAN process improvement project for procurement card program (Pcards) 3. Council Reports 4. Consent Agenda Items listed are considered routine by the City Council and will be enacted by one motion without discussion. A Council member may request to remove an item from the Consent Agenda and, if approved, it will be placed on the regular agenda for discussion and consideration. A. Approval of minutes from the May 18, 2021 City Council regular meeting B. Resolution authorizing the execution of an agreement with to rehabilitate the East General Aviation Apron at the Yakima Air Terminal -McAllister Field C. Resolution authorizing a Lease Agreement with James R. Richmond and Susan Y. Richmond for property located at 2035 Airport Lane, Yakima Air Terminal -McAllister Field D. Resolution awarding bid and authorizing agreements for purchase and delivery of rock for the Nelson Dam Project E. Resolution authorizing a reimbursement agreement with the Washington State Department of Health for the COVID-19 Mass Vaccination Site F. Resolution authorizing a contract with Total Site Services, LLC for the Viola Ave. Waterline Replacement on East Viola Avenue. G. Ordinance amending the 2021 Budget for the City of Yakima; and making appropriations from Unappropriated Fund Balance within the Capitol Theatre's Capital Fund for expenditure during 2021 for capital expenditures (Second Reading) 5. Public Comment Community members are invited to address items listed on the meeting agenda. There will be 35 minutes allotted for public comment with two and a half (2.5) minutes per speaker in order to allow as much opportunity as possible for audience participation. Written communication and e-mail messages are strongly encouraged. PUBLIC HEARINGS 6. Public meeting to consider citizen comments on the proposed 2021 Annual Action Plan for Community Development Block Grant (CDBG) and HOME Fund Programs 7. Public hearing on the Yakima Housing Action Plan 0 4:7-11,1W J 41TIIId 8. 2021 State Legislative Session Review 9. Other Business 10. Adjournment The next meeting will be a City Council study session on June 8, 2021, at 5:00 p.m. at City Hall 11. Council General Information A.
